Understanding Your Finances
Before you set your gambling budget, it’s essential to have a clear understanding of your overall financial situation. Take the time to assess your income, necessities, and other obligations to determine what amount you can comfortably allocate to gambling. To do this effectively, consider the following steps:
- Review Your Monthly Income: Calculate your total income from all sources to establish a baseline for budgeting.
- Identify Necessary Expenses: List all your essential expenses, including housing, utilities, groceries, and transportation.
- Assess Discretionary Spending: Determine how much money remains after covering necessities, which can be assigned to your gambling budget.
By having a comprehensive view of your finances, you can set a realistic and responsible gambling budget that suits your lifestyle without jeopardizing your financial well-being.

Set a Specific Budget
Once you’ve analyzed your finances and defined your gambling objectives, it’s time to set a specific budget. This should be a fixed amount that you can afford to lose over a certain period. Here are some tips for defining your budget: Online casino
- Choose a Timeframe: Decide whether your budget is for a single gaming session, a week, or a month.
- Prioritize Loss Limits: Determine how much you’re willing to lose, understanding that losses are part of gambling.
- Set Win Goals: Consider setting a win limit to secure profits; for instance, if you double your budget, it’s wise to quit while you’re ahead.
Having a specific budget in place not only helps prevent overspending but also encourages disciplined gaming habits that can enhance the enjoyment of online casinos.
Regularly Review and Adjust Your Budget
Setting a budget is not a one-time task; it requires regular evaluation and adjustments based on your gambling activity and financial circumstances. Here are some points to keep in mind:
- Track Your Gambling Activity: Maintain records of your wins and losses to gain insights into your gambling habits.
- Assess Financial Changes: Be ready to adjust your budget if your financial situation changes significantly, such as a job change or unexpected expenses.
- Stay Disciplined: Resist the urge to dip into your savings or take on additional debt to continue playing if you hit your budget limit.
By taking the time to regularly review your budget, you can ensure that it remains aligned with your financial goals and gambling experiences at online casinos in Saskatchewan.

FAQs
1. How much should I allocate for my gambling budget?
It varies based on your financial situation and gaming goals, but always choose an amount you can afford to lose.
2. What happens if I exceed my gambling budget?
If you exceed your budget, take it as a warning sign and stop playing until you reassess your finances and budget.
3. Can I set a budget for different types of games?
Yes, you can create a separate budget for different games based on their risk levels and your personal preferences.
4. Is it necessary to track my wins and losses?
Keeping track helps you understand your gambling habits and make informed decisions about your future budgets.
5. What are the signs I should stop gambling?
Signs include feeling stressed about money, losing track of time, or experiencing emotional distress related to gambling outcomes.
